Apple has slashed the development team for Aperture, its professional image software for RAW-format work flow, the insider news Web site Think Secret has reported.
The team’s engineers have been absorbed by other departments or completely let go, according to the Web site.
The move is not entirely a surprise, as the software has seen a host of problems. Software glitches, such as an initial incompatibility with Intel-based Macs, have plagued Aperture since its release.
Aperture was also challenged by Adobe’s release of comparable RAW-image work-flow software. (more…)

When you’re editing an image to remove stuff like age wrinkles, it’s just better all around if you work with an image that hasn’t been sharpened. Sharpening increases contrast along edges in an image — edges much like, well, wrinkles. This increase in contrast makes these features even more prominent — and therefore more difficult to excise. This is one of many reasons not to apply sharpening to your original image. (If you absolutely must sharpen an image, be sure to save an unsharpened version that you can use later for editing purposes if you have to make some adjustments.) .

Adobe InDesign CS2 Tip – Type Glitch?
You decide to change the color of a headline, so you select the type and click on a Swatch from the Swatches palette. You deselect the type and realize that you’ve added a Stroke to your lettering instead of a Fill. Hmm, how did that happen? Why did the Type tool Default to Stroke? It just doesn’t make sense considering it’s so rare that you need to change or add a Stroke to type. Is this an InDesign bug? Nope! You actually caused the problem without realizing it. No matter what tool you’re using, if you activate the Stroke icon in one of your palettes, it stays activated until you activate Fill. Switching to your Type tool does not automatically switch to Fill in your palettes. So what seems like a totally random Stroke activation is not random at all. It’s just the way InDesign is designed to work.
